At Refemme we strive for textile waste diversion through garment repair, mending, upcycling and alterations. Gabriela, the founder and Seamstress, promotes the Mending principles through workshops hosted at creative studios such as The Scrappy Elephant and The Annex at Bluebird in Crozet, VA.
Also, Refemme has been present every month at local Boutiques like DarlingxDashing to offer In-store alterations and clothing repair services as an effort to combat the Fast Fashion pollution.

This is Gabriela, the face behind Refemme and the hands behind the seams. I am a Fashion enthusiast and an avid thrift shopper. My background in Fashion dates back to the origin of my first clothing brand back in Mexico during my college years.
I started Refemme after having my very own "Slow Fashion awakening" that led me to a whole year free of buying new clothes, which mixed with my sewing skills led me to create Refemme. A brand that promotes a more consciences way to dress, an initiative that strives to reduce the stigma around getting your clothes altered or fitted but most importantly: a community that shares the vision for a world free of textile waste. A world where we care more for the planet and the clothes we already own.
When I moved to town in August 2022, I started volunteering at Twice is Nice sorting clothing donations and for me it was eye opening to see the amount of clothes that were being donated due to small flaws like missing buttons, torn seams, rips and holes. I thought about the difference that it would make if more people knew how to sew back a button or some of the principles to approach this common repairs.
That is how the Visible Mending Workshops started across town, with the one desire to let everyone know that "Mended is the new black". That there is nothing wrong with having our clothes mended and that there is actually joy in owning every single rip, patch, hole and stains in our jeans. Mending clothes is not only an act of love but a way to counterattack the pollution the fashion industry produces as the second most polluting industry in the world.
